Transaction 269a81ec0d9a6afd213c331abe722583c11a4248decf568c8c23f69f610fba7e
1 Input
1 Output
-
269a81ec0d9a6afd213c331abe722583c11a4248decf568c8c23f69f610fba7e:0
- value
- 706400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6788ce253245be6200d34f237c29ddfc35c50653 OP_EQUAL
- address
- 3B8TQhSVdJt999kQ4cW42PdP3CU7qBetdF